gin-swagger icon indicating copy to clipboard operation
gin-swagger copied to clipboard

build(deps): bump github.com/swaggo/swag to v2

Open RiccardoM opened this issue 8 months ago • 1 comments

Describe the PR Bumps the swaggo/swag dependency to v2, allowing to properly generate and render Open API v3.x specifications.

Additional context Currently the this library does not support generating and visualizing Open API v3.x specifications. Since this has been out for quite some time, I think it's time to fix this.

There is another related PR that also has to be merged for this to work properly: https://github.com/swaggo/files/pull/28. This will introduce the ability to render an OpenAPI v3.x documentation without breaking any backward compatibility.

RiccardoM avatar Mar 10 '25 20:03 RiccardoM

Can this be merged? It would be great to have Open API v3.x support

ctm8788 avatar May 21 '25 20:05 ctm8788

Hello, I really need this feature to be merged. I guess @ubogdan is the reviewer we need?

titouanj avatar Jun 19 '25 09:06 titouanj

I haven't ever run a branched package like this, can we get a beta version of this deployed and I would be happy to test it out.

mcooper-pb avatar Jun 26 '25 18:06 mcooper-pb

+1

SebastianOsuna avatar Oct 31 '25 23:10 SebastianOsuna